Shuttering Joiner Agency: Search Consultancy Location: Middlesbrough Search Consultancy is looking for an experienced Shuttering Joiner to join our busy civils and structures teams across Middlesbrough. We are partnering with leading groundwork contractors and RC frame specialists who require "formwork" experts capable of constructing precise moulds for heavy-duty concrete pours and structural foundations. If you are a Joiner who thrives in a high-volume environment and can move seamlessly from traditional timber shutters in deep excavations to advanced proprietary systems like PERI or Doka, we have immediate starts and long-term runs of work available now. The Role Formwork & Shuttering: Constructing and installing high-quality timber and system shutters for foundations, ground beams, retaining walls, and pile caps. Groundwork Support: Working alongside groundworkers to ensure all sub-structure formwork is perfectly aligned, braced, and "concrete-ready." System Knowledge: Utilising modern formwork systems (e.g., PERI, Doka, Skydeck) as well as traditional bespoke timber-built shutters. Technical Accuracy: Reading and interpreting site drawings to ensure all structures are built to the exact line, level, and dimensions required by the site engineer. Striking & Maintenance: Safely striking (dismantling) formwork once the concrete has cured and ensuring equipment is cleaned for the next pour. Productivity Driven: We need Joiners used to the speed of major Teesside civil engineering and industrial projects who can maintain high output while ensuring a "water-tight" finish. Requirements CSCS Card: A valid Blue or Gold card is mandatory. Experience: Proven track record in shuttering and formwork specifically within a groundwork or heavy civils environment. Technical Skills: Ability to work accurately from drawings and experience with both timber "tube and fitting" and system formwork. Physical Fitness: Must be comfortable working in excavations and capable of handling heavy shuttering panels and equipment. Joiner Location: Newcastle upon Tyne Agency: Search Consultancy (Construction & Trades Division) Payment Terms: 25.00 per hour (CIS, Weekly Pay) Start Date: Immediate (Subject to reference and credential verification) Position Type: Full-Time Contract Duration: Ongoing long-term work The Opportunity Search Consultancy's Construction and Trades Division is currently partnering with a premier tier-one contractor to recruit a time-served, highly skilled Joiner for active projects centrally located in Newcastle upon Tyne. This is a premium contract offering an immediate start and a consistent, ongoing run of local work across both high-volume commercial developments and busy housing sites. The project demands a tradesperson who possesses a meticulous eye for detail, a strong work ethic, and the ability to maintain exceptional production rates without compromising on quality. For a reliable, professional joiner, this position offers excellent stability and long-term continuity of work within the North East region. Remuneration & Financials CIS Rate: 25.00 per hour (Gross assignment rate) Payment Frequency: Processed accurately every single Friday via our dedicated payroll desk, ensuring reliable weekly cash flow with zero hidden administrative or umbrella fees. Comprehensive Key Responsibilities Operating within fast-paced commercial and residential environments, your daily schedule will demand high efficiency, technical competence, and seamless collaboration with site management and other trades. Your responsibilities will include, but are not limited to: First & Second Fix Installation: Executing high-quality first-fix tasks (including stud work, timber partitioning, roof structures, floor joists, and window frames) and precise second-fix installations (including internal doors, skirting boards, architraves, ironmongery, and kitchen fittings). Technical Blueprint Reading: Interpreting complex engineering drawings, architectural blueprints, and specifications to measure, cut, and assemble timber components accurately on-site. Structural Timbering: Constructing timber frameworks, partitions, and temporary structures safely and according to strict structural design layouts. Snagging & Handover Preparation: Carrying out thorough snagging, detailed adjustments, and final touch-ups on high-end commercial finishes and housing plots prior to final client handover. Tool & Machinery Maintenance: Operating hand tools, power tools, and site machinery (such as chop saws, routers, and drills) safely and keeping them properly maintained. Health & Safety Compliance: Maintaining a clean, hazard-free workspace, managing materials efficiently to reduce waste, and strictly adhering to site safety guidelines. Rigid Candidate Requirements To maintain the high standards required on these projects, candidates must explicitly meet the following criteria prior to deployment: Valid CSCS Card: A valid Blue (Skilled Worker) or Gold (Advanced Craft/Supervisor) CSCS card is mandatory for site access and will be verified beforehand. Industry Experience: A proven, demonstrable track record working as a Joiner across both commercial developments and housing sites. You must be comfortable working on large-scale site footprints. Qualifications: Time-served or relevant NVQ Level 2/3 or City & Guilds qualifications in Carpentry and Joinery. Complete Trade Kit: Possession of a full, professional kit of both hand and 110V/cordless power tools. Full 5-Point PPE: Ownership of standard site protective equipment (Hard hat, high-vis jacket/vest, steel toe-cap boots with adequate ankle support, protective gloves, and safety glasses).
